Product Overview

Category

The LD29300D2M18R belongs to the category of low-dropout voltage regulators.

Use

It is used to regulate voltage in various electronic devices and circuits.

Characteristics

  • Low dropout voltage
  • High output voltage accuracy
  • Thermal shutdown protection
  • Short-circuit current limit

Package

The LD29300D2M18R is available in a small package, typically a TO-263-5L or D²PAK-5L package.

Essence

The essence of LD29300D2M18R lies in its ability to provide stable and regulated voltage output for electronic applications.

Packaging/Quantity

The LD29300D2M18R is usually packaged in reels or tubes, with quantities varying based on manufacturer specifications.

Specifications

  • Input Voltage Range: 4.5V to 26V
  • Output Voltage: 1.8V
  • Maximum Output Current: 3A
  • Dropout Voltage: 450mV at 3A
  • Operating Temperature Range: -40°C to 125°C

Working Principles

The LD29300D2M18R works by comparing the reference voltage with the feedback voltage to adjust the output voltage, ensuring a stable and regulated output.
